Verdict

INNCOENT TOUCH seems to be an improving hurdler and this recent C&D winner can defy a rise from the handicapper to take another step up the ladder. Cool Sky is most feared of the rivals and he is a pretty smart hurdler on quick ground. Mister Universum, the youngest horse in the field is also of some interest for the prolific Skelton team.
